Job Description

Description

The Staff Electrical Engineer will work on project teams to create world-class designs for new projects, alterations, and redevelopments on a variety of projects including power, process, corporate, healthcare, pipeline airports, institutional, industrial, manufacturing, government, and military facilities. The Staff Electrical Engineer will work with the project team throughout the design and construction process, adapting electrical plans according to budget constraints, design factors, or client needs.

  1. Perform electrical design of projects from the conceptual phase through design completion.
  2. Modify and review production drawings for a variety of projects including, but not limited to: power plants, process facilities, industrial facilities, healthcare facilities, airports, educational institutions, commercial, and governmental and military facilities.
  3. Design electrical components for project needs and requirements that are set forth by the project managers.
  4. Applies strong knowledge of commonly used electrical engineering/design concepts, principles, practices, codes, and procedures within the electrical engineering services industry.
  5. Research and compile project-related data as required by the project managers.
  6. Update drawings provided by senior engineers to verify corrections are made within multiple CAD related software.
  7. Compile information for client presentations, shop drawing review, and contract administration for the design of power, process, pipeline, industrial, healthcare, airports, educational institutions, commercial, and governmental and military facilities.
  8. Perform field inspections, measurements, or calculations for public and private clients.
  9. All other duties as assigned.
  10. Comply with all policies and standards.

Qualifications

  1. Bachelor’s degree in electrical engineering or related degree from an ABET accredited program and 3 years of electrical engineering experience, consulting preferred.
  2. Bachelor’s degree in electrical or related Engineering Technology from an ABET accredited program and successful completion of Fundamentals of Engineering (FE) exam and 3 years of electrical engineering experience, consulting preferred.
  3. Master’s degree in electrical engineering and 2 years of electrical engineering experience, consulting preferred.
  4. Strong knowledge in standard engineering techniques and procedures.
  5.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
  6. Ability to work methodically and analytically in a quantitative problem-solving environment and demonstrated critical thinking skills.
  7. Proficient in standard engineering techniques and procedures.
  8. Strong computer skills include AutoCAD, MicroStation, 2D and 3D rendering programs, and other analysis programs.
  9. Strong attention to detail, facilitation, team building, collaboration, organization, and problem-solving skills.
  10. Engineers in Training (EIT) Certification Preferred.
